Now that Viktor Gyokeres has officially signed for Arsenal, the question has moved on to whether he will be a success with the Gunners. His goal record speaks for itself at Sporting, with the forward scoring 97 goals in 102 appearances and providing 26 assists during his time in Portugal.
After months of speculation, the club have agreed a €63.5m fixed fee with a further €10m in add-ons for Sporting CP's free-scoring striker
